AFC Gamma, Inc. (NASDAQ:AFCG) has appointed Brandon Hetzel as Chief Financial Officer and Treasurer, effective immediately. The Board of Directors approved this appointment on March 17, 2023. Hetzel has been with the company since September 2020 and has a strong background in real estate finance. He succeeds Brett Kaufman, who has left the company as part of efforts to rightsize the accounting team. Hetzel's experience includes work in real estate development and asset management, as well as a managerial role at PricewaterhouseCoopers. AFC Gamma specializes in lending secured by commercial real estate, including loans for state-law compliant cannabis operators.
AFC Gamma, Inc. (NASDAQ:AFCG) reported its fourth quarter 2022 GAAP net income at $2.9 million or $0.14 per share, with Distributable Earnings at $12.6 million or $0.62 per share. For the full year, GAAP net income was $35.9 million or $1.80 per share, with Distributable Earnings reaching $49.9 million or $2.51 per share. A cash dividend of $0.56 per share was declared for the first quarter of 2023. The company highlighted its strong liquidity position and continued focus on credit quality in the face of macro challenges, while Robyn Tannenbaum was appointed as President, signaling leadership continuity. The 2023 Annual Shareholders Meeting is scheduled for May 18, 2023.

AFC Gamma, Inc. (NASDAQ:AFCG) declared a quarterly dividend of $0.56 per share for the quarter ending December 31, 2022. This dividend, representing a 12% year-over-year increase, will be payable on January 13, 2023, to stockholders of record as of December 31, 2022. AFC Gamma is known for providing lending solutions primarily to established operators in the cannabis industry, leveraging over 100 years of combined management experience.
